But I have limited knowledge about Conder tokens. Any info regarding to this? Does it belongs to "circulating coins"?

I appreciate for your time and patience. :)
It is in great shape. Conder tokens were used as a result of shortage of actual money. Certain places started making their own money and didn't have the King on them. Some companies made some too.

Yes, the Royal Mint concentrated on making higher denominations, so it was left to locals to make the 1/2 Penny and 1 Penny (and others) tokens. The name Conder was someone who made the first catalogue of them.
